Scroll to navigation

HOMESICK(1) User Commands HOMESICK(1)

NAME

homesick - keep your dotfile in git

DESCRIPTION

Commands:

# Open a new shell in the root of the given castle
# Clone +uri+ as a castle for homesick
# Commit the specified castle's changes
# Delete all symlinks and remove the cloned repository
# Shows the git diff of uncommitted changes in a castle
# Execute a single shell command inside the root of a castle
# Execute a single shell command inside the root of every cloned castle
# generate a homesick-ready git repo at PATH
# Describe available commands or one specific command
# Symlinks all dotfiles from the specified castle
# List cloned castles
# Open your default editor in the root of the given castle
# Update the specified castle
# Push the specified castle
# Run the .homesickrc for the specified castle
# Prints the path of a castle
# Shows the git status of a castle
# add a file to a castle
# Unsymlinks all dotfiles from the specified castle
# Display the current version of homesick

Runtime options:

# Overwrite files that already exist
# Run but do not make any changes
# Suppress status output
# Skip files that already exist
February 2015 homesick 1.1.2